Method of machining V-notch grooves for controlled fragmentation of warheads

An improved method of machines grooves forming Pearson notches in a pattern on hollow shell casings for munitions for at least one of increased functionality and/or performance. Rather than running a broach through a hollow casing, a CNC lathe with a multi-axis tool with cutting implement can precisely locate and form grooves along either an interior or an exterior surface of a hollow shell casing.

Precision Case Holder

A precision case holder engages the extraction groove of the rim of a straight wall case and established a fixed distance between a base of the case and a precision forward surface of the holder. The case may then be inserted into a case trimmer and the holder establishes a repeatable distance between the base of the case and a cutting tool in the case trimmer. The holder includes a tapered slot with edges which engage the extraction groove and a threaded piston which is tightened against the base of the case. The case slides into the tapered slot until the taper resists further sliding, and the piston is tightened to retain the case.

Case Trimmer with Sliding Sleeve

A case mouth trimmer and chamferer includes a clear sliding sleeve covering windows in a barrel portion to capture trimmings. The case mouth chamfer tool may be fixed to a micrometer dial threadedly engaging the barrel. A case adapter bearing is fixed to the barrel to position cases. An end m ill is used trim the case length or a case mouth chamfer tool is adjusted to cut an inside chamfer and the micrometer dial is rotated to adjust the position of the end mill or the case mouth chamfer tool with respect to the case adapter bearing to precisely adjust the amount of material cut from the case. An adjustable cutter holder member slides in a dovetail, is adjusted by advancing and retreating a screw, and is held in place by a set screw. The case adapter bearing is easily changed to chamfer different cases.
